Output 84f9d6e3ad14af0f81e3e313fd6e770d325bf7d3295049527c402e59c1d96a95:0

value
20886648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db45a29b04523f2db39a408251180cfaa33af385 OP_EQUAL
address
3MgRKtfai18Hg85orDvyTRtwGBiZPxbV6W
transaction
84f9d6e3ad14af0f81e3e313fd6e770d325bf7d3295049527c402e59c1d96a95
spent
true